Baguettes and sandwiches are staple lunch diet in Oxford, these are a few places you might wish to try in Oxford for a quick bite. Note some places offer large discounts after 4.30pm to get rid of stock so if you are on a budget or can wait this long it might be tempting..
Bonjour Rapide A Modern elegant sandwich bar and delicatessen that offers a wide range of sweet and savoury Pastries and an extensive choice of hot and cold sandwiches.
The Buttery This is a small, but decent Sandwich Shop/ Deli located in the heart of the University in Oxford. The Buttery offers a range of sandwiches and baguettes, as well as your usual coffees, teas, pastries and cakes.
La Croissanterie Povides croissants and sandwiches, good for lunch.
Mortons Mortons has been established for over 10 years as one of Oxfords favourite sandwich bars. With 4 outlets in the city centre, Mortons certainly has things covered. This is a great place for a quick lunch, whether you sit in or take away.

Le Petit Pain Le Petit Pain sell a range of freshly baked baguettes as well as sandwiches, snacks and hot and cold drinks. They provide a small scale local delivery service.
Pret-A-Manger Pret A Manger create handmade and natural foods to eat in or take away. Their chillers are always well stocked with ready made sandwiches, salads, fruit pots. They also offer hot and cold drinks.
Queen's Bakery (Headington) Queens Bakery sell a wide range of freshly baked goods as well as a selection of sandwiches, pies and cakes. They also serve hot beverages.
